Lawrence Allen Coleman, 79, of Cedar Grove, West Virginia, passed away peacefully on January 16, 2026. Born on March 27, 1946, in Cedar Grove, West Virginia, Lawrence lived a life marked by dedication to family, hard work, and quiet strength.
A proud Army veteran, Lawrence served his country honorably during his time stationed in Germany. Following his military service, he returned home to West Virginia and built a long and steady career as a coal miner, a profession that reflected his resilience and commitment to providing for those he loved.
Lawrence was a devoted husband to his beloved wife of 59 years, Linda Daniels Coleman. Together they raised a close-knit family that brought him immense pride and joy. He is lovingly remembered by his children: Roger Coleman (Missy), Jerry Coleman, and Scott Coleman (Shannon). His legacy continues through his grandchildren: Christopher Coleman (Amy), Kathleen Hernandez (Tommy), Roger Coleman (Brandy), Hanna Murrell (Isaac), and Zoey Coleman; as well as twelve great-grandchildren who brought light into his later years.
He also leaves behind six siblings who shared in the many chapters of his life. Lawrence was preceded in death by his daughter Theresa Coleman; his parents, Myrtle and Virgil Coleman and his sister Freda O’Daniels.
Outside of work and service, Lawrence found joy in the simple pleasures of life. He loved fishing and camping—activities that allowed him to connect with nature and spend cherished time with family. Above all else, he treasured moments spent with his grandchildren and great-grandchildren, whose laughter and presence were among his greatest joys.
His memory will live on in the hearts of those who knew him best. May it bring comfort to all who mourn his passing.
